    So who is looking forward to the "New Mini", 2nd half 2013?

    It now appears there is a second iteration of the Mini in the pipeline. Shades of iPad 3 & 4 or a natural progression?

    A report from SlashGear details that AU Optronics, one of the companies that supplies Apple with panels for the current iPad Mini (@1024x768) are expecting "to begin 2048x1536, 7.9 inch displays by the second half of 2013, with a pixel density of 324PPI."

    So Apps designed for the Retina screens should look fantastic also on "The New Mini". Or will we call that Mini 2? At least Apple may be reverting to an annual product cycle, at least for the Mini?
